  4. Twellium Industrial Company -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Twellium_Industrial_Company

    Twellium Industrial Company was established in September 2013 to manufacture, retail, and market nonalcoholic beverages. [2] In February 2014, the company obtained the franchise from Monarch Beverage Company [3] to produce four beverages including Rush Energy drink, Original American Cola, Planet Range and Bubble Up lemon lime.

  6. Sting Energy -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Sting_Energy

    Sting Energy (or Sting) is a carbonated energy drink produced by Rockstar Inc. (acquired by PepsiCo in 2020). Sting is available in flavors such as the original Gold Rush, Gold (with Ginseng), Power Pacq (Gold Rush with Malunggay), Power Lime (Kiwifruit/Lime), Berry Blast (Strawberry) and blue thunder (blue raspberry).
